‘Silence’ Gang Tied to Bank Heist in Bangladesh – Report

Russian-speaking gang known for its slow and methodical attacks against banks and ATMs. Dutch Bangla Bank Ltd, along with at least two other local banks in Bangladesh, reportedly were targeted by attackers that used malware planted in ATMs to collect cash. Group-IB researchers found evidence that Silence was able to implant several Trojans within the bank’s network. The gang is making good on its plans to move beyond Russia and other countries in Eastern Europe to more targets in Asia and Western Europe.”]
